TWC Athletic Hall of Fame 

The purpose of the Hall of Fame is to identify and honor in a permanent manner those individuals who have achieved excellence in athletics at Tennessee Wesleyan College and others who have contributed to the advancement of Tennessee Wesleyan athletics by their support of time, resources, or both.

The award is divided into three categories:

Outstanding Athlete: Those who have achieved excellence in athletics at Tennessee Wesleyan College and are 15 years removed from his/her playing date.

Outstanding Coach: Those who have advanced and enhanced the concept of athletics at Tennessee Wesleyan College through their talents as coaches in their respective communities. 

Outstanding Contributor:  Those who have contributed to the advancement of Tennessee Wesleyan College athletics and who are classified as non-athletes or coaches, and who may or may not have matriculated at Tennessee Wesleyan College.
